Transitions - Bobby Fischer
 
Bobby Fischer, the greatest American chess player since Paul Morphy, has died in Iceland.

When he beat the Soviet Union's Boris Spassky to become the World Champion in 1972, he beat the USSR at their own game.

He was also a SERIOUS weirdo in this latter years and alienated many people here in the U.S. by broadcasting anti-Semitic diatribes and expressing support for the September 11th attacks in New York.

R.I.P. to a truely great chess player.
